Birmingham Children’s Trust is looking for dedicated Contact Workers to support supervised contact visits between children in care and their families.\n\n This is a hugely rewarding role where your presence, professionalism, and ability to build trust will make a real difference to children’s emotional wellbeing.\n\n About the Role As a Contact Worker, you will facilitate and supervise contact sessions between children in care and their parents or family members, ensuring visits are safe, positive, and child-focused.\n\n You’ll act as a neutral, supportive presence — observing interactions, promoting positive engagement, and ensuring safeguarding procedures are followed at all times.\n\n Key Responsibilities\nSupervise contact visits between children in care and their families\n\nEnsure the safety, wellbeing, and emotional needs of children are always prioritised\n\nSupport positive and appropriate interactions during contact sessions\n\nAccurately record observations and write clear contact notes/report...
